Subtract 49/20 from 6/48
1st number: 6/48, 2nd number: 2 9/20
6/48 - 49/20 is -93/40.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 48 and 20 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 48 × 5 = 240,
6/48 = 6 × 5/48 × 5 = 30/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 20 × 12 = 240,
49/20 = 49 × 12/20 × 12 = 588/240 - Subtract the two like fractions:
30/240 - 588/240 = 30 - 588/240 = -558/240 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-93/40
